šŸ“– Scripture:
“Whatever you do, work at it with all your heart, as though you were working for the Lord and not for people. Remember that the Lord will give you as a reward what he has kept for his people. For Christ is the real Master you serve.” — Colossians 3:23–24 (GNTD)

šŸ“œ Background:
Paul writes to the Colossians to encourage them in their new life in Christ. These verses remind believers that their work—whether in ministry, daily tasks, or service—is ultimately for the Lord. This perspective transforms ordinary labor into sacred offering and invites joy into even the most routine responsibilities.

šŸ’” Devotional:
One September morning, I was prepping materials for a small group gathering—printing devotionals, arranging chairs, checking snacks. It felt simple, almost unnoticed. But as I read Colossians 3:23–24, I was reminded: ā€œWork at it with all your heart… for Christ is the real Master you serve.ā€

Harvest isn’t just about gathering—it’s about how we labor. When we work with joy, knowing our efforts are for God, even the smallest tasks become meaningful. Whether you’re leading a team, caring for children, writing devotionals, or cleaning up after a meal, your work matters. It’s part of the harvest.

If you’ve felt unseen or weary in your work, this is your reminder: God sees. And He rewards faithfulness—not just results. Work with joy, because you’re serving the One who never overlooks your labor.
